Completed mural inside the 52nd FW post office courtesy of U.S. Air Force Staff Sgt. Tiara Gripka, 52nd Force Support Squadron postal clerk, Jul. 10, 2020, Spangdahlem Air Base, Germany. The mural is located inside the main lobby of the post office and covers the entire wall where the shipping boxes were once located, providing a shot of color and brightness to the otherwise sterile interior.......

The Spangdahlem Fitness Center has reopened to U.S. Active Duty members by appointment only with restricted operations guidelines, Jun. 19, 2020, Spangdahlem Air Base, Germany. These new specific restrictions and limitations are to ensure health and safety standards set forth by the DoD are met while still providing the best possible fitness services.
